Basic calculation is simple. In words it is usage divided by inventory. So if Usage 400 and inventory is 200 then Turns = 2.

Web2 de jan. de 2024 · Another way to calculate your Cost of Goods Sold, is to add the total value of your beginning inventory, plus inventory purchased and subtract any inventory that remains to be sold. See the formula below. Cost of Goods Sold = Beginning Inventory Value + Value of Any Inventory Purchased during the period – Ending Inventory Value.
